Question
drag the missing word into place but it’s all relative; the train leaves the station; it speeds up, that’s blank. options: acceleration, position, fast.
Brief Explanations
In physics (a subfield of Natural Science), acceleration is defined as the rate of change of velocity. When a train speeds up, its velocity is changing, which is acceleration. "Position" refers to where an object is, and "fast" describes speed (magnitude of velocity), but speeding up is a change in velocity, so acceleration is the correct term.
